The postcode DE22 1GB is located in Derby It was introduced in August 1992 and is an active postcode. DE22 1GB is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
DE22 1GB is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DE22 1GB as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Indian tech achievers.
The closest road name to DE22 1GB is Carsington Mews which is centered 224 m away.
The nearest bus stop is University Bus Park and is 81 m away. The closest railway station is Derby Rail Station, 3.34 km away.
The closest primary school to DE22 1GB (for ages 11 and under) is Lawn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on September 23, 2021.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Jasmine Hall School.
The local pub for residents of DE22 1GB is The Pot Hole and is 580 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 5,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Papa John's and is 580 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 1, 2019.
Policing for DE22 1GB is covered by the Derbyshire police force association and Derby City is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
